A Poultry Exhaust Fan is a heavy-duty ventilation fan specifically designed for poultry farms, chicken sheds, hatcheries, and livestock housing to remove heat, humidity, ammonia gases, dust, and foul odours. These fans maintain fresh airflow inside poultry houses, ensuring a healthy environment for birds and improving productivity.
��️ Purpose & FunctionPoultry exhaust fans work by:
-
Pulling stale, hot, and contaminated air out of the poultry shed
-
Allowing fresh air to enter through ventilation openings
-
Maintaining proper temperature, humidity, and air quality
This helps prevent heat stress, respiratory issues, and disease among poultry.

A Blower is a mechanical device used to move air or gas at high velocity and pressure for ventilation, cooling, drying, dust removal, combustion support, and material handling. Unlike normal fans, blowers are designed to deliver stronger airflow with higher pressure, making them suitable for industrial, commercial, and specialized applications.
⚙️ How a Blower WorksA blower operates using a motor-driven impeller that draws air into the unit and forces it out at increased pressure. Depending on the design, the air may change direction (as in centrifugal blowers) or move in a straight line (as in axial blowers), enabling efficient air movement for different requirements.

Smoke extraction fans are typically mounted in strategic locations such as rooftops, ducts, or openings in walls. When activated (manually or automatically via fire alarm systems), the fan draws smoke and hot air out, creating a safer environment by:
-
Lowering smoke concentration
-
Reducing toxic gas buildup
-
Improving visibility for occupants
-
Helping control fire spread
Unlike regular ventilation fans, smoke extraction fans are designed for high temperatures and continuous operation under extreme conditions.
🌬️ Key Features of Smoke Extraction FansHere’s what makes them different from ordinary fans:
🔹 High Temperature ResistanceBuilt with heat-resistant materials and motors capable of withstanding very high temperatures (often specified as 200 °C, 300 °C, or more for a set duration).
🔹 High Airflow CapacityDesigned to move large volumes of air quickly for rapid smoke removal.
🔹 Fire-Rated ConstructionMany are tested and certified to meet fire safety standards defined by local building codes.
🔹 Heavy-Duty MotorsEquipped with robust motors suitable for emergency operation and reliable performance when needed most.
🔹 Integration with Fire Safety SystemsCan be connected to fire detection systems so they activate automatically in case of fire or smoke detection.
🔹 Durable & WeatherproofSuitable for both indoor and outdoor installations, often with corrosion-resistant housings.
🛠️ Why Smoke Extraction Fans Are ImportantSmoke extraction fans play a critical role in life safety and building design, including:
✔ Faster evacuation during emergencies
✔ Reduced smoke damage and heat stress
✔ Improved conditions for firefighters
✔ Compliance with fire safety regulations
These fans are often required in places like shopping malls, hospitals, industrial plants, high-rise buildings, theatres, and parking garages.

A Dust Cleaning Blower is an electric air-blowing device designed to remove dust, debris, and fine particles from surfaces, equipment, machines, and hard-to-reach areas using a high-velocity stream of air. It is commonly used in homes, workshops, industries, electronics maintenance, and commercial cleaning.
Industrial blowers generally use a motor-driven impeller to generate airflow, enabling efficient removal of dust and contaminants from surfaces.
��️ Working PrincipleDust cleaning blowers operate by:
-
Using an electric motor to rotate a fan or impeller
-
Producing high-speed airflow
-
Blowing dust out of crevices, machines, or surfaces
Such blowers are often used where vacuum cleaning is difficult, since they blow dust away rather than sucking it in.

An exhaust hood (also called a kitchen hood, range hood, or ventilation hood) is a ventilation device installed above cooking equipment, industrial processes, or workstations to capture and remove smoke, heat, grease, fumes, odours, and airborne contaminants. It improves air quality, safety, and comfort by directing polluted air outside or through filtration systems.
��️ How an Exhaust Hood WorksAn exhaust hood works by:
-
Capturing contaminated air at the source (e.g., cooking range or machinery)
-
Pulling it through filters or ducts using an exhaust fan
-
Expelling it outside or cleaning it before recirculation
This prevents heat, grease, or fumes from spreading into the surrounding area.
